조건부연산자
-
JavaScript 입문 : 가위바위보 게임 - 승부내기, 점수 계산하기컴퓨터 알아가기/JavaScript 2022. 7. 13. 19:30
이 글은 제로초 TV의 자바스크립트 강좌를 기본으로 하고 있습니다. 이제는 본격적으로 가위바위보 게임의 규칙을 찾아서 승부를 내고 승부 결과에 따라 점수를 계산하는 프로그램을 고민해 보는 시간인데요. 조금 어렵긴해도 천천히 진행하면서 이해해 볼려고 합니다. 1. 조건부 연산자를 사용하여 내가 선택하는 게임 연결 무슨말이냐 하면 가위바위보 3가지 경우를 컴퓨터와 게임을 하는데 내 선택도 필요합니다. 현재까지는 가위 바위 보에 대한 HTML 버튼만 만들어 놓은 상태에서 내가 선택하는 기능을 추가해야 합니다. HTML 구문을 보면 다음과 같이 되어 있습니다, 여기서 JS상에서 연결 시켜줄 수 있는 방법은 event target을 사용하는 방식인데 '가위', '바위', '보'는 textContent 이므로 ev..
-
JavaScript 입문 : 조건부 연산자 (Conditional Operator), 반복 while문컴퓨터 알아가기/JavaScript 2021. 11. 19. 19:30
본 내용은 제로초 TV의 자바스크립트 강좌와 MDN Mozilla를 기본으로 하고 있습니다. ▒ 조건부 연산자 (Conditional Operator) 1. 기본 연산 조건부 연산이란 조건에 따른 참과 거짓에 따라 결과값을 나타내는 것을 의미합니다. 다음과 같은 구조로 이루어져 있습니다. 조건(식) ? 참일 경우 결과값 : 거짓일 경우 결과값 예를 들어 간단한 덧셈예제를 가지고 이해를 해 보겠습니다. 상기 예제처럼 결과값이 2인 경우는 참으로 나옵니다. 변수를 사용하는 경우도 보겠습니다. 결국 변수의 값이 참인지 거짓인지 확인할 수 있습니다. 기본적으로 조건부 연산자의 개념은 조건에 대한 ? 가 참과 거짓을 확인하고 그 결과값을 반환하는 프로세스라고 보면 되겠습니다. 조건부 연산자라는 개념은 역시 조건이..